Output 14df73588ee6731765359f010ecfe8c27417639927602b63310fef2c82353710:65

value
64968180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6e53f90d5163956432a66f59d84ca8e7df2abb OP_EQUAL
address
MDKQGUQYBmH2pyJEVqQkukjXkq2KynF9kU
transaction
14df73588ee6731765359f010ecfe8c27417639927602b63310fef2c82353710
spent
true